How does a persons belief system affect an individuals decisions
Vlad [161]

A person's beliefs shape the filters they use to analyze the information at the outset of the decision-making process, which in turn affects how they perceive reality. This reality perception has an impact on our judgments and choices. These decisions and conclusions have a tendency to support the initial ideas.

A concept that a person holds to be true is referred to as a belief. A belief may be founded on facts of faith, probabilities, or certainties (such as mathematical concepts). A belief might originate from a variety of sources, such as one's own experiences or experiments.

They have an impact on your thoughts, actions, decisions, and methods. Your perspective on things will be influenced by your history, upbringing, experiences, and connections, among other things. You might occasionally make unfair or unjust assumptions about someone as a result of your attitudes and beliefs.

A person's commitment to and perception of the value of a belief will mature into a value over time. Beliefs can be divided into various categories of values; examples include values related to happiness, prosperity, career success, and family.
